## Quotaflow Environments

Quick heads-up before you review the PR: per-tenant rate quotas on Quotaflow differ between staging and prod, which trips people up constantly. Staging hands every tenant the same generous bucket, while prod scales quotas by plan tier and clamps burst traffic hard. If your change touches the limiter middleware, test against prod-like numbers or you'll get false confidence. The enforcement window is sliding, not fixed, so off-by-one math matters. Here are the current prod values for reference.

deployment values, taweg-bajop:
[fenvan]
port = 5672
team = holmir
host = fenvan.orvexio.example
region = lower-1
access_code = ac_b98bc6
timeout_ms = 1500

Ticket: Staging env misconfigured for Siftgate bloom filter

The bloom layer in front of the Pellet KV store is rejecting all lookups in staging because the env file was copied from the dev template without credentials. False-positive tuning values are fine; only the auth line is missing. To unblock the weekly demo, the Pellet admission secret must be set on the following line.

env line for yaguf-fajop: LEDGER_TOKEN13=fb08984397349

The Orvane Labs bike cage and the east and west parking gates operate on separate access schedules, and facilities desk staff should note that visitor vehicles may only use the west gate between 07:00 and 19:00. Cyclists requesting cage access must show a valid day pass, and their details should be entered in the access ledger before the cage is opened. Gates must never be propped open, even briefly, during deliveries. When a manual override is required at either gate, use the code below.

staff pass of fadup-fawig = bdg-FUNKS-4

**Alert: sheet-export-memory-high**

Heads up — this fires when the Gridnote spreadsheet exporter climbs past 80% of its memory ceiling. Usually it's one giant workbook with embedded images, not a leak, but worth a look since oversized exports have been a data-exfil vector before. Check whether the requesting account is doing anything weird. Triage notes and the review checklist live on the page here.

wiki page, bahip-fahaf: https://gitlab.nelvrolabs.corp/view/spaces/dash/1df3a1d01c73